Metal roof repair services involve assessing and addressing issues that compromise the integrity and performance of metal roofing systems. Skilled contractors inspect roofs for common problems such as rust, corrosion, loose or missing panels, and punctures. Repairs may include replacing damaged sections, sealing leaks, reinforcing seams, and applying protective coatings to extend the roof’s lifespan. These services aim to restore the roof’s ability to withstand weather elements and prevent further deterioration, ensuring the property remains protected over time.
The primary problems metal roof repair services help resolve include leaks, rust formation, and physical damage caused by severe weather events like hail or high winds. Over time, exposure to the elements can lead to corrosion or wear that weakens the roofing material. Repair specialists work to eliminate leaks that can cause water damage to the interior, address corrosion spots to prevent structural weakening, and fix damage from impacts or debris. Timely repairs can prevent more costly issues and extend the overall durability of the roofing system.

Cost Range for Metal Roof Repairs - The typical cost for repairing a metal roof varies between $300 and $1,500,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. Minor repairs, such as patching leaks, tend to be on the lower end of this range. More extensive work can approach the higher end, especially for large or complex roofs.
Factors Influencing Repair Costs - Costs can fluctuate based on the size of the roof, type of metal, and severity of the damage. For example, localized leaks might cost around $300 to $700, while replacing large sections could reach $2,000 or more. Access difficulty and location also impact pricing estimates.
Average Repair Expenses - On average, homeowners in Springfield, VA, might spend between $500 and $1,200 for standard metal roof repairs. This range includes common issues like rust treatment, sealant application, or replacing damaged panels. Prices may vary based on contractor rates and specific needs.
Additional Cost Considerations - Emergency repairs or those requiring special materials can increase costs beyond typical estimates. It’s advisable to contact local service providers for detailed quotes tailored to specific roof conditions. Costs are approximate and can differ across projects and regions.
